Match Commentary

  • 0': First Half begins.
  • 42': Goal! Blackpool 0, Luton Town 1. Sonny Bradley (Luton Town) header from the left side of the six yard box to the high centre of the goal. Assisted by Kal Naismith with a cross following a corner.
  • 45': Substitution, Luton Town. Pelly-Ruddock Mpanzu replaces Henri Lansbury.
  • 54': Goal! Blackpool 0, Luton Town 2. Elijah Adebayo (Luton Town) header from very close range to the bottom left corner. Assisted by Jordan Clark with a cross.
  • 59': Substitution, Blackpool. Josh Bowler replaces Demetri Mitchell.
  • 64': Substitution, Blackpool. Shayne Lavery replaces Owen Dale.
  • 77': Substitution, Luton Town. Admiral Muskwe replaces Carlos Mendes Gomes.
  • 78': Substitution, Blackpool. Sonny Carey replaces Kenneth Dougall.
  • 82': Substitution, Luton Town. Danny Hylton replaces Elijah Adebayo.
  • 90'+1': Goal! Blackpool 0, Luton Town 3. Jordan Clark (Luton Town) right footed shot from the centre of the box to the bottom right corner. Assisted by Admiral Muskwe.
